Enjoy the backcountry feeling in our most remote yurt.

Retreat in our magical Mountain Brook Yurt and enjoy this sacred refuge in the forest, under a canopy of trees, and nestle into your private getaway on the slopes of Pleasant Mountain. The sites and sounds of the nearby mountain stream are truly mesmerizing. Our mountain yurt retreat provides all the essentials and especially the opportunity to truly unplug. The Mountain Brook Yurt is accessible year-round by a rugged, sloped footpath following a 10 minute~1000 foot climb. Make this your base for outdoor recreation and adventure, with hiking or (snowshoeing) trails right out side your yurt door, outdoor recreation, eco-adventure, and those that want to check out the surroundings in Western Maine’s lakes and mountains region or nearby Mt Washington Valley in New Hampshire.   The Yurt does not have solar power and does not have wi~fi.  There is no running water at your yurt; however, we do supply you with jugs of pure mountain water, and a compost toilet nearby.  There is not a bathroom in the yurt.  There is a warm shower at the top of the access road, where you can refill your jugs for drinking, cooking and dishes.  This is a about a 5 minute hike. We provide the yurt with a 2-burner propane stove for your simple cooking along with all the dishes, utensils, pots/pans, etc.  You heat your yurt by wood stove for your tending and we provide ample wood for your stay.
